Public Law:
Whether it contain of those fields or branches of law where such the state has an interest as the sovereign egg criminal law, administrative law, constitutional law,.
Public law is concerned through the constitution and functions of the various organs of government counting local authorities, their relations with each other and through the citizens. So public law asserts state sovereignty or power.
Private law:
Further it consists of those fields or branches of law that the state has no direct interest like the sovereign egg law of contracts and law of tout and law of property and law of succession.
Private law is troubled through day to day transactions of legal relationships between persons. Well it describe the rights and duties of parties.
